Output 31bf3d7c80210a243b38d8fd466ef2a3350d089e2ffa0d4c04d22ac445c4768b:0

value
10586220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b7d41b1edd7208c845a134535a3e5e77a910fea7 OP_EQUALVERIFY OP_CHECKSIG
address
1HkzkV5FS6HA98kDruBUJi8HVdRtLbQto3
transaction
31bf3d7c80210a243b38d8fd466ef2a3350d089e2ffa0d4c04d22ac445c4768b
spent
true